Besom Cottage, Chesterfield

Besom Cottage is a detached character property over 300 years old in Holymoorside near Chesterfield. Original oak beams feature throughout this historic building. The cottage sits on the border of the Peak District National Park with stunning views over rolling countryside.

The location offers direct access to public footpaths. Surrounding countryside walks and cycle paths make this perfect for outdoor enthusiasts. Chesterfield provides excellent transport links nearby.

The cottage sleeps four guests across two king-size bedrooms. Bedroom one has an en-suite shower and WC. Bedroom two features a zip-and-link bed (convertible to twins on request) with a bathroom containing a slipper bath and enclosed shower.

The kitchen-diner includes a working Aga and traditional farmhouse table. The lounge has a wood burner and comfortable sofas. An enclosed patio garden includes built-in BBQ facilities.

Chatsworth House and Gardens sits 6 miles away (15 minutes). Bakewell town and its famous pudding shop is 8 miles distant (20 minutes). Haddon Hall lies 8 miles away (18 minutes). Hardwick Hall stands 7 miles from the cottage (16 minutes).

Besom Cottage suits couples and families wanting Peak District access with period character. The working Aga and wood burner create a cosy retreat.
